13.12.2013, 18:24 | #1 |
Участник
|
Журналы ГК. Количество строк.
DAX 4.0
Требуется разнести журнал ГК из 8000-10000 строк. Какие минусы могут быть? Пока имею: большое потребление памяти на операцию разноски, длительную проверку, длительную разноску. |
|
13.12.2013, 21:06 | #2 |
Участник
|
Интересно, с какой целью надо разносить это одним журналом?
|
|
13.12.2013, 22:32 | #3 |
Участник
|
В настройках названий журналов ГК издавна есть параметр наподобие "Максимальное число строк", рекомендуется устанавливать его в районе 500. При использовании этой настройки код разноски будет разбивать большой журнал на несколько маленьких (по границе ваучера, разумеется), которые суммарно проверяются и разносятся намного быстрее, чем один мега-журнал.
PS учтите, что журнал разносится в одной транзакции. Если вдруг что, она откатится, и часы ожидания окажутся потрачены впустую. Последний раз редактировалось gl00mie; 13.12.2013 в 22:35. |
|
|
За это сообщение автора поблагодарили: mazzy (2), S.Kuskov (2), dech (2). |
17.12.2013, 11:50 | #4 |
Участник
|
это всё я понимаю.
|
|
17.12.2013, 13:14 | #5 |
Участник
|
Можно сразу создать N-ое журналов с небольшим количеством строк и разносить все журналы в пакете через периодическую операцию "Разноска журналов".
Есть еще вариант не использовать журналы. Создать табличку в которой находятся данные для разноски и написать обработку по разноске этих данных. Далее запускаем несколько пакетов и все разноситься. Мы используем этот вариант, 250 тыс. проводок разносятся около 30 минут. |
|
17.12.2013, 13:33 | #6 |
Administrator
|
Цитата:
Сообщение от anikulichev
Можно сразу создать N-ое журналов с небольшим количеством строк и разносить все журналы в пакете через периодическую операцию "Разноска журналов".
Есть еще вариант не использовать журналы. Создать табличку в которой находятся данные для разноски и написать обработку по разноске этих данных. Далее запускаем несколько пакетов и все разноситься. Мы используем этот вариант, 250 тыс. проводок разносятся около 30 минут.
__________________
Возможно сделать все. Вопрос времени |
|
17.12.2013, 13:39 | #7 |
Участник
|
Данная функция доступна и на 4 версии. То что AX 2009 пакетник стал на аосе, это извесно, но старый режим никто не отключал.
Последний раз редактировалось anikulichev; 17.12.2013 в 13:48. |
|
17.12.2013, 15:08 | #8 |
Administrator
|
Цитата:
А вот с функцией Разноска журналов - я действительно не помню. Мне казалось - что она появилась только в 2009.
__________________
Возможно сделать все. Вопрос времени |
|
29.01.2014, 10:44 | #9 |
Участник
|
Есть официальные рекомендации Microsoft на счёт максимального количества строк в разносимых журналах?
|
|